Bulletin Board February 7, 2008
Search Archives


Fundraisers
Feb. 8-14

• Gift-Wrapping Service, sponsored by East Brunswick Hadassah, during regular mall hours, at the Brunswick Square Mall, Route 18, East Brunswick, to benefit all Hadassah projects, including medical research for a breast-cancer cure. For a nominal fee, gift items purchased from any store in the mall or elsewhere will be wrapped with seasonal or all-occasion papers and decorated with creative ribbon designs. Gifts may be wrapped while shoppers wait or dropped off for a later pickup. Corporate gift-wrap services available. (732) 947-8757.

Feb. 10

• Knights in Our Hearts Forever Spring Prom Fashion Show, sponsored by the Old Bridge High School (OBHS) PTSA, 1 p.m., in the auditorium at Old Bridge High School, Route 516. Approximately 90 students and several administrators, Old Bridge Superintendent of Schools Simon M. Bosco, Assistant Superintendent for Human Resources Francis Perrino and OBHS Principal James Hickey will model formal attire. Admission is $8 per person; includes door prizes, refreshments. Raffle tickets, 50/50s sold. Accessories and prom wear displays. Call Desiree DiPrima at (732) 583-4561.

• Pancake Breakfast, sponsored by Prodigal Foundation Inc., a nonprofit organization dedicated to helping children affected by cancer throughout Middlesex County, 8-11 a.m., at the Woodbridge Elks Lodge, 665 Rahway Ave. Cost is $6 for adults, $3 for youngsters ages 5-10; youngsters under age 5 admitted free of charge. (732) 636-9200. www.prodigalfoundation. com.

Feb. 12

• Scholastic Book Fair Friends and Family Event, sponsored by Madison Park School, 6-8:30 p.m., in the school library, 33 Harvard Road, Parlin section of Old Bridge. Public invited. Call Wendy Schaefer at (732) 313-6384, e-mail Gottabandaid@aol.com.

• Proceeds Night, sponsored by the Samsel Upper Elementary School PTO, Sayreville, 10 a.m. to 9:30 p.m., at Subway Sandwiches and Salads, Route 9 south, Wal-Mart Plaza, Old Bridge. Participants should tell their server they are there to support the Samsel Upper Elementary School PTO. Restaurant will donate 15 percent of each supporter's bill (pretax) to the PTO. Call Christine Flaherty at (732) 727-3193.

Feb. 14

• TGIF Night, sponsored by the Sayreville War Memorial High School (SWMHS) Bombers bowling team, 5-9 p.m., at TGI Friday's, Route 9 north, Old Bridge. Supporters should tell their servers they are there to support the SWMHS bowling team. The restaurant will donate 20 percent of each bill (excluding alcohol) to the team. Call Debbie at (732) 257-7730 or Nancy at (732) 525- 2498.
